Ball in New York This is an original press photo. New York - French statesman Jean Monnet, left, architect of the European Common Market, receives the 1962 freedom award of Freedom House in New York tonight from George W. Ball, U.S. Under secretary of state. Formal presentation of the award, a bronze plaque, was made at dinner honoring Monnet for his efforts in pressing for a united Europe.Photo measures 8.25 x 10inches. Photo is dated 01-23-1963.
